In the latest DC comic Batman: Urban Legends, "Robin" Tim Drake came out as bisexual. This week's "Sum of Our Parts" story tells about Tim Drake as Robin going to rescue his old friend Bernard, who was having dinner with Drake in a restaurant when Bernard was captured by Chaos Monster. Later, without knowing Robin's true identity, Bernard confided to him that "it would be nice if the date with Drake could end successfully." The story takes a turn. Later, Drake visited Bernard and talked about what happened that day. He said that he had thought a lot, and Bernard asked him: "Do you want to go out with me?" Drake said: "Yes." Tim Drake is the third generation Robin. He is a young and promising young man who often goes on adventures with Batman and others. He is also a witness to the "Flying Grayson Family Murder Case" and an important member of the Bat Family, the Young Justice League and the Teen Titans. Currently, Tim is active with Batman as Red Robin, helping him and other members of the Bat Family fight crime. |
